Million Dollar Trash Pick

by Joshua Johnson on October 25th, 2007

Million Dollar Painting

I saw an interesting story a couple of days ago about the most lucrative trash find I’ve ever heard of (it comes from MSNBC.com): Painting Worth $1 Million Found in Trash.  (The painting is pictured above, courtesy of the article named.)

Aparently, a lady found a stolen painting in the trash and decided it was worth taking home to hang in her house.  Decades later, the lady found out that “her” painting had been stolen before it went into the trash.  The former owners paid her 55,000 for the painting–apparently it is estimated that the painting will be sold for ”up to $1 million at its Latin American Art auction on Nov. 20.”
